"During our brief stay at Cannon Beach, we visited Insomnia as a walk on the beach isn't complete without a beverage in hand. Little did I know that the pastry would take center stage. As we were ordering our drinks loose leaf iced black tea for me, latte for my wife we noticed the raspberry scones beautifully displayed near the register. Although we rarely order baked goods to accompany our morning drinks, we went against our usual restraint as we knew miles of hiking were in the near future and we had read that the pasties were made in house. Well, the first scone led to the purchase of a second as sharing was not an option. It was magical. It was buttery, it was soft, it was tart and sweet a marvel in my mouth. My wife insisted we purchase a third for the road and we are glad we did. Whether you drink coffee or not, a visit to Insomnia is a must. The pastry chef is a genius and her works of art are a must have during your visit."
